Microchange management uses a synchronized combination of cues, nudges, and suggestions, along with targeted rewards and recognition. It builds on prominent thinking from books like Nudge and Atomic Habitsby applying it to large programs and moving beyond individual tasks and goals to the team and the … See more Large-scale enterprise transformation takes a long time, and value realization typically takes even longer. However, thinking micro allows an organization to deconstruct larger transformation into a number of smaller … See more As microchange programs are deployed, you need to frequently assess these initiatives to ensure they accomplish desired outcomes.
